Title: Geert Maertens - Innovator in Cancer Diagnostics

Introduction

Geert Maertens is a distinguished inventor based in Mechelen, Belgium, known for his contributions to the field of cancer diagnostics. His work primarily focuses on identifying microsatellite instability (MSI) and optimizing the processing of nucleic acids from biological samples.

Latest Patents

Geert Maertens holds two significant patents that address critical challenges in cancer detection. The first patent involves a biomarker panel and methods for detecting microsatellite instability in various cancers, including colorectal, gastric, and endometrial tumors. This innovative diagnostic marker panel facilitates the analysis of MSI loci and provides tools for detecting cancers associated with MSI and mismatch repair (MMR) deficiencies.

His second patent centers on improved compositions and methods for isolating nucleic acids from biological samples. These advancements allow for the direct downstream processing of liberated nucleic acids in microfluidic systems. The described methods and kits are invaluable for diagnosing, staging, and characterizing various biological conditions.

Career Highlights

Geert Maertens is currently affiliated with Biocartis NV, where he applies his expertise to push the boundaries of cancer diagnostics. His innovative approaches contribute to the development of more efficient and accurate diagnostic tools that have the potential to enhance patient outcomes.

Collaborations

Throughout his career, Geert has collaborated with notable coworkers such as Bram De Craene and Klaas Decanniere. These partnerships are instrumental in fostering an environment of innovation and advancing research in cancer diagnostics.
